The woman found guilty of manslaughter for the death of her boyfriend plans to appeal her conviction. Danielle Allen, 23, was found guilty of second-degree manslaughter last week. She is the daughter of a New York State Police inspector. Allen stabbed her boyfriend, Marcus Postell, in her apartment in York back in November of 2016. Allen's attorneys said they are appealing due to 'pre-trial issues.' If her conviction is upheld, Allen could spend a maximum of 15-years in prison.
